In 2016 I was fitted for a PING G driver. It turned out to be the LS model with the Ping Tour 65 S shaft.

I like the driver a lot in terms of performance. According to Arccos I average 267 yards with 18 yards of dispersion.

The one thing I don’t like about it is the sound; which for me translates to feel. To me it sounds like a tin can which kind of ruins the feel for me.

 

Okay so mid-way through this year, I got a chance to replace it. I got fitted (At a different fitter) and loved the sound/feel of the Cobra F8. So, I got fitted up. Ended up getting the F8+ with the black Project X HZRDUS 6.0 75 gram shaft.

I like this driver a lot too. The sound/feel is great! Here’s the issue; According to Arccos I hit this driver an average of 256 yards with 21 yards of dispersion. So it’s 11 yards shorter and 3 yards less accurate???

I’ve played roughly the same number of holes with each driver (A dozen rounds with each this year), on pretty much the same courses. I’ve switched back and forth, I think I’ve hit the same conditions, or at least enough rounds to get similar data. I know Arccos uses the center of the fairway as my target, which isn’t always the actual target, but I would think that would come out in a 10 round wash.

 

Neither driver has averaged the distances I was averaging during the fitting session, but I think that’s to be expected. Fitting was done indoors on both, launch monitor not real world, plus you hit driver after driver and kind of groove your swing.


Anyway, I’ve gone back to the PING G now, even though I don’t like the sound it makes. For me it simply performs better.

My question is does anyone game a club that perhaps doesn’t perform as well as another, but because you prefer the feel/sound of it? Or maybe there is another reason to play an underperformer? I mean I really wanted to like the Cobra better. But the data just isn't there.

Use the Ping wrench that came with the club and unscrew the round weight on the sole.  Take some yarn and feed in through the hole into the head.  Try about 20 feet of yarn and put the screw back on.

 

see how u like it.  Sound will be great, it'll add a little weight but you can easily go back in and fish it out to put in more or less yarn.
